Explore projects
-
memoriav / Memobase 2020 / services / Import Process / Mapper Service
GNU Affero General Public License v3.0A service to map resources and properties from one data model into an other.
UpdatedUpdated -
memoriav / Memobase 2020 / services / Import Process / Normalization Service
GNU Affero General Public License v3.0A micro service to normalize rdf data by selecting a number of operators and configure them accordingly.
UpdatedUpdated -
memoriav / Memobase 2020 / services / Drupal Ingest Service
GNU Affero General Public License v3.0This service offers an API to ingest and update institutions and record sets from Drupal into the rest of the backend and updates all the necessary things.
UpdatedUpdated -
memoriav / Memobase 2020 / services / Import Process / XML Data Transform
GNU Affero General Public License v3.0A microservice which prepares XML files for the mapper service. Uses XSLT for the simplification and then generates a flat JSON document.
UpdatedUpdated -
memoriav / Memobase 2020 / libraries / General Service Utilities
Apache License 2.0Provides utility classes, functions and constants used in many JVM based services.
UpdatedUpdated -
CI/CD components for gradle projects
Updated -
memoriav / Memobase 2020 / services / Elasticsearch Services / Elasticsearch Connector Service
GNU Affero General Public License v3.0This service reads the contents of a Kafka topic and ingest each message as a document into elasticsearch.
UpdatedUpdated -
memoriav / Memobase 2020 / services / postprocessing / JSON-LD Serializer
GNU Affero General Public License v3.0Transforms RDF-Serialization from NT to JSON-LD. Can use frames.
UpdatedUpdated -
memoriav / Memobase 2020 / services / Import Process / Text File Validation
GNU Affero General Public License v3.0A service which searches a sftp server folder and validates and reports the text files found.
UpdatedUpdated -
memoriav / Memobase 2020 / services / Import Process / Json Data Transform
GNU Affero General Public License v3.0Reads and transforms json metadata files.
UpdatedUpdated -
Updated
-
memoriav / Memobase 2020 / services / Elasticsearch Services / Search Doc Service
GNU Affero General Public License v3.0Transforms a given JSON-LD resource into a search index document.
UpdatedUpdated -
memoriav / Memobase 2020 / services / Import Process / Reports Processing
GNU Affero General Public License v3.0A small service to move the header information into the message body for each report.
UpdatedUpdated -
memoriav / Memobase 2020 / services / Import Process / Media-Linker
GNU Affero General Public License v3.0A micro service which links digital instantiations metadata documents with the file found on the sftp server if the file is imported into memobase.
UpdatedUpdated -
memoriav / Memobase 2020 / services / Import Process / Table Data Transform
GNU Affero General Public License v3.0A service which reads table data formats (CSV, TSV, XSL, XSLX, ODS) from a sftp server and transforms them into json objects per row. The keys are taken from a header row.
UpdatedUpdated -
swissbib / linked / baseline-preprocessor
GNU Affero General Public License v3.0A micro service to edit some marc record.
Updated -
swissbib / linked / kafka-consumer-files
GNU Affero General Public License v3.0Mircoservice that writes messages into files (with compression)
Updated -
swissbib / linked / N-Triples Analyzer
GNU Affero General Public License v3.0Microservice to analyze n-triple data sets. Reads a kafka topic with ntriples resources per message and output a analyzable data profile for each resource in json.
Updated -
swissbib / linked / streams-app-kotlin-skeleton
GNU Affero General Public License v3.0Template for Kotlin Kafka Streams applications.
Updated -
swissbib / linked / kafka-producer-files
Apache License 2.0Reads various file formats and produces messages.
Updated